about Like Arrows – When conflict, rebellion and resentment overwhelm their family, Charlie and Alice are forced to change their parenting strategy, and are surprised to find effective, life-long solutions were closer than they imagined. FamilyLife’s first feature explores the joys and heartaches of parenting. Through a journey that unfolds over 50 years, Charlie and Alice discover the power of family, and learn that knowing and living by God’s word is the most important key to parenting with purpose.
“Like Arrows” stars Alan Powell (“The Song”), Alex Kendrick (“War Room,” “Courageous”) and newcomer Micah Lynn Hanson. It was directed by Kevin Peeples.
